大家好,今天小编关注到一个比较有意思的话题,就是关于2d网络游戏开发的问题,于是小编就整理了5个相关介绍2d网络游戏开发的解答,让我们一起看看吧。
2d游戏怎么编程?
编程使用 Visual Studio的Visual C++ ,需要懂得C++(包括C),Windows编程
2D图像 贴图等 主要用Photoshop 或Painter
3D建模 3DS MAX ,MAYA ,MILKSHAPE ,LIGHTWAVE等很多
脚本编程 PHYSON , LUA 等
音乐加工 Cool Edit, Goldwave等
开发成型可玩的游戏是个很复杂的过程,以上各项要求必须会用,另外还包括游戏逻辑系统设计,关卡设计,测试等等。
2d网页游戏开发引擎?
1.Impact :支持桌面环境和移动端,支持所有主流浏览器: FIrefox, Chrome,, Safari, Opera 和 IE 。
2.Craftjs 是另外一个完美的游戏引擎,提供一个开发杰出游戏的接口,并且跨浏览器兼容。
3.playcraft 引擎提供给开发者许多工具集,帮助开发各种类型的游戏,这些工具集非常强大,可以让开发者自由发挥自己的各种想法,并且可以很容易转换到其他的平台,比如 Facebook,旧版的网站,原生 Android 和 iOS 应用等等。
4.Jaws 是个 HTML5 驱动的 2D 游戏库,刚开发的时候只能用来制作 canvas,现在支持通过同样的 API 来制作普通基于 DOM 的 sprites。支持的浏览器:Chrome 9+, Firefox 3.6+, Safari 5+ & IE9。
5.Enchant.js 是个简单的 JavaScript 框架,可以使用 HTML5 和 JavaScript 来开发简单的游戏和应用。现在还是由 UEI 的 Akihabara 研究中心来开发和维护。
不会编程能用unity做简单2d游戏吗?
如果是unity的话估计可以,因为unity它自带可视化编程,可是问题是这个可视化编程也需要你有一定的编程基础,不过如果是有去制作做简单的游戏的应该够了,不过时间要花费的久一些,简单来说不会编程,用unit是可以做2D的简单游戏的
Unity3D能否开发2D游戏?
当然。Unity3D是一个跨平台的游戏引擎,它提供了3d游戏的大部分基础功能实现,比如物理碰撞、3d模型显示、光照等功能,简化了使用者开发游戏的过程,更能够节省非常多的成本。
ug2d动态铣编程方法?
UG2D动态铣编程是一种在UG软件中进行的动态铣削加工的编程方法。下面是一种常见的UG2D动态铣编程方法的步骤:
创建零件模型:首先,在UG软件中创建需要进行动态铣削加工的零件模型。确保模型准确无误,并设置好加工区域和切削区域。
创建刀具:根据实际情况,在UG软件中创建刀具模型,并设置好刀具的参数,如刀具直径、刀具长度等。
定义加工区域:使用UG软件的加工区域定义功能,将需要进行动态铣削加工的区域定义出来。可以通过绘制边界、选择曲面等方式来定义加工区域。
定义切削区域:根据实际情况,使用UG软件的切削区域定义功能,将需要进行切削的区域定义出来。可以通过选择曲面、边界等方式来定义切削区域。
创建刀轨:使用UG软件的刀轨创建功能,根据实际情况创建刀具的运动轨迹。可以通过选择曲线、边界等方式来创建刀轨。
定义切削参数:根据实际情况,设置好切削参数,如进给速度、切削深度、切削宽度等。
生成刀具路径:使用UG软件的刀具路径生成功能,根据刀轨和切削参数生成刀具的加工路径。可以选择合适的刀具路径生成策略,如等距离切削、等角度切削等。
优化刀具路径:根据实际情况,对生成的刀具路径进行优化,以提高加工效率和质量。可以调整刀具路径的顺序、修剪多余路径等。
模拟和验证:使用UG软件的模拟功能,对生成的刀具路径进行模拟和验证。确保刀具路径与实际加工需求相符,并检查是否存在干涉等问题。
导出NC代码:最后,将生成的刀具路径导出为NC代码,用于实际的数控机床加工。
需要注意的是,UG2D动态铣编程方法的具体步骤可能会因实际情况而有所不同,上述步骤仅供参考。在实际应用中,还需要根据具体的加工要求和机床设备进行相应的调整和优化。
到此,以上就是小编对于2d网络游戏开发的问题就介绍到这了,希望介绍关于2d网络游戏开发的5点解答对大家有用。
还没有评论,来说两句吧...